One of these ways is eWOM.  Defining eWOM and its importance for hospitality industry The full form of eWOM is Electronic word of mouth and can be defined as the customer reviews that are posted on Social Media as well as other websites. The marketing experts have studied the importance and relation of eWOM with existing and future paying customers and the relation between content of eWOMand increase in sales volume.  The main mediums of eWOM include blogs, social media sites such as facebook, pintereste, Twitter and others. This medium also includes various popular travel websites where most of the people do their bookings, chat rooms and other user-generated websites in this field. It is a fact that the hospitality business in UK must pay attention to these online reviews, as most of the potential customers prefer to check the reviews before booking of the room in any UK Hotel (Melián-González, Santiago, Bulchand- Gidumal,, Jacques and González López-Valcárcel, Beatriz (2013)). Due to this, the hospitality industry should keep the negative reviews at minimum and positive reviews at the maximum. One way with which this can be done is to contact the person who has posted negative reviews and sort out the issue.  These studies also consider some factors such as the role of volume and valence of eWOM for an increase in sales for future. The volume of reviews of any hotel affects the (RevPAR revenue per room. The valance refers to the ratio of positive review vs the negative review and has a lot of effect over business of luxury hotels. The volume refers to the number of reviews posted on relevant websites, blogs and other social media (Melián-González, Santiago, Bulchand- Gidumal,, Jacques and González López-Valcárcel, Beatriz (2013)). It is a known fact that first few reviews on any UK hotel or any other facility are invariably negative. However, it has been conclusively proved that as the number of reviews increases, so the positive tenor of the reviews and the valance of the reviews becomes balanced and negative effect of the reviews is mitigated.  eWOM and the performance in sales of UK Hospitality industry he effect of eWOM has been studied by experts in many fields, especially in hospitality marketing. With these studies, it has been proved extensively that the effect of eWOM largly depends on the customer segment or product segment.  This relationship varies as per the customer well as market segment and the characteristics of the products. These studies prove that the eWOM is used more for the reviews of high-end hotels and accommodation places than mid-range or lower end range of UK hospitality industry. These methods include online surveys, telephone interviews; online customers review, etc. As most of the customers who book the rooms of hotels around UK are foreign visitors, it is imperative that the management group should focus on this group by contacting them online.  Approaches to Consumer Behavior Research There are two types of approaches to consumer behavior research 1. Traditional consumer behavior research The traditional approach to consumer behavior research can be divided into two types that are known as positivist and interpretivist approaches. Positivist Approach In this type of approach, the author can generalize the consumer actions that are based on the cause and effect. The author can test the consumer actions with empirical research and measured objectively. This type of market research is based upon Quantitative methodology and requires large samples.  Interpretivist approaches In this type of approach, the author cannot generalize the cause and action as a consumption pattern as well as behavior is unique and unpredictable. The author cannot test the consumer action with empirical research and objectively as every consumer is considered unique and different. This type of market research is based upon Qualitative methodology and requires small sample (Sahney, 2011). 2. Current Consumer Behavior Research The current consumer behavior research considers all types of human behavior and is widely known as Dialectical approach. This approach to consumer behavior research is very broad in scope and includes 4approaches that include Contradiction, Totality, Change and materialism. These approaches use both qualitative as well as a quantitative approach in the studies.  Relation of Market Research with Consumer Behavior It is a known fact that every individual is unique and different from other people and consequently, their desires, requirements, tastes differs from the others.
